bigkesh:As much as Ibime is right to an extent, we have to be careful about which information we accept and which we don't. My own knowledge of the saga is very different. As far as I know, no one frustrated Jose. Jose identified his own targets in the summer - Paul Pogba and John Stones. The club did not say no to this, neither did Emenalo. In fact, the board supported him and I guess with the blessing of Emenalo to shell out money on the two players. The support was not limited to boardroom discussion either, they went out there and bid for both players - up to £40m for Stones and up to £65m for Pogba depending on the stories you read. The problem, as I understand, was Jose was too hopeful of both signings that he put all his eggs in these "two" baskets so to speak. When it was clear that Everton was not going to sell Stones, Jose asked the club to bid for Marquinhos. PSG rejected two bids from Chelsea. Again, this is the board backing Jose again and if you ask me, signed and approved by Emenalo the TD. http://www.skysports.com/football/news/11668/9975281/chelsea-fail-with-two-bids-for-paris-saint-german-star-marquinhos Mikel was on the verge on joining Turkish side Fernabache. It was reported by many outlets that they had sealed a £12m bid. Jose blocked the move after realising the Pogba deal fell through. So abeg, no soul is frustrating Jose. The problem is the long standing inability to mould a team, work with young players that are just about to break through and then build a formidable on the hunger they show. Instead, time and again, he wants to work with the established stars. Not that anything is wrong with that. But when he seems to "ONLY" want to work with top of the range talent that costs tens of millions, then I have a problem. People should open their eyes to what he really was. | Re: Official Chelsea Fan Thread: Club World Cup Champions 2025-2029 by Ibime(m): 5:56pm On Dec 22, 2015*. Modified: 6:32pm On Dec 22, 2015 |
nateevs:We have debated this extensively and you were one of the naysayers when Emenalo did the same to RDM, even going as far as telling us that Mike Powell is Emenalos boss. Hahahaha. Remember that? You are chatting rubbish about Mikel joining Fernebahce. Emenalo deliberately jacked the price of Mikel to $15m so as not to sell Mikel. It was a game they were playing with Jose after Jose requested Mikel be sold. Mikel that is about to have twins with this Russian billionaire girlfriend and his brother sell him away to Turkey or Dubai? ![]() The difference between us is that we both read the same thing but you don't see what is going on, or refuse to cede the truth. There was never any offer for Mikel because of the price Emenalo deliberately put on his head to keep him. So why don't we hear it from Fernebahce President himself: http://weaintgotnohistory.sbnation.com/2015/7/12/8936415/chelsea-want-35m-for-mikel-says-fenerbahce-chairman “Chelsea want €15 million and Mikel asked for €5 million a season over four years. We are talking €35 million. That is not possible” Yildirim told reporters at their Topuk Yayla training ground. You've been on the wrong side of the debate from RDM times. Mikel is out of here for free transfer left to Jose. As for Jose wanting Pogba you may have a point. That is the point of starting your transfer window in June but no, Emenalo blocked all transfer negotiations until Roman released him to go negotiate for Pogba after the Man City defeat. If bids had been made for Pogba in a timely fashion and rejected, then you identify replacements and have time to buy. Thats why Witsel was no2 on the list but by the final week when Roman gave the green light, Zenith said its too late for them to find replacement. That is how transfer market works. Who was Emenalo's alternative to Pogba? Emenalo has no interest in replacing Mikel. Full stop. We could talk about Baba Rahman - Mourinho wanted Danny Rose, they argued and Emenalo signed Rahman. Mourinho identified (1.) Stones and (2.) Aldeweireld in that order - by the time Emenalo shuffled his feet to move on Stones, Aldeweireld was gone. This is how transfer market works, so save the nonsense for the kids. I would never claim JM has a wide array of transfer targets. He is not a scout. His job does not allow him watch evey game in every league. But you can go back in history and check the calibre of player JM bought - Drogba, Essien, Ballack, Carvalho, Cole etc. They were expensive but extremely solid niggas we got 10 years out of. At some point we stopped spending money because these niggas did the job year after year. When a coach identifies a need, sometimes it is only that player that can do what he wants tactically. Just like Bayern must have Javi Martinez in 2012 or Thiago in 2013 or just like SAF must have RVP in 2012, or even Guardiola must have Ibrahimovic in 2009 whatever the cost - they identify that nigga and that nigga only for the needs of the team. The same goes for Essien when Jose bought him. You can compare with the Zhirkovs, Salahs and Cuadrados bought with no thought of what specific role the coach has in mind - they come, they flop, and they need replacing almost immediately.
